How many of each animal does Aaron have to purchase to spend 100$ and get exactly 100 animals?

Aaron walks into a pet store and has 100 dollars to spend on buying 100 animals. He must spend all the money. Dogs cost 15 dollars, cats cost one dollar, and mice are twenty five cents. Aaron has to buy at least one of each animal.
